Output 17a59a8c2d925bfe5027ea9797d5284fa5567ffe5feeecb959e05b804d779b23:2

value
513350631
script pubkey
OP_0 OP_PUSHBYTES_20 9a9c659f0e6a3408d4eae4342619b959e024c43e
address
ltc1qn2wxt8cwdg6q3482us6zvxdet8szf3p7zvmdw6
transaction
17a59a8c2d925bfe5027ea9797d5284fa5567ffe5feeecb959e05b804d779b23
spent
true